Because our focus is not only on nourishing our customers, but also about enriching you.This position is not eligible for Visa Sponsorship.Position Summary: In this role, you are accountable for providing HR support to all salaried, hourly employees and site leadership through effective communication and administration across all functions of the facility. Under the direction of the HR Manager, the Sr. HR Generalist/Business Partner leads recruitment, employee development, labor relations, policy interpretation, compensation administration, and legal compliance.Primary Responsibilities: Execute HR Strategy:

  • Aid in execution of the Nestle People Strategy processes that attract, develop, recognize, and retain employees to support the organization's short- and long-term strategic business needs.
  • Support Nestle initiatives such as the Nestle Management and Leadership Principles while executing workforce planning processes for the organization such as talent development, organizational planning, and organizational change management
  • Ensure the culture & working environment is open, empowering, fair, and equitableRecruitment:
    • Oversee salaried and hourly staffing processes to ensure the site staffing plan is and the right talent is selected to align with business requirements relative to the key function on-site. Performance & Talent Management:
      • Utilize the performance, talent, and organizational planning management systems to help drive the achievement of company goals through objective and development plan setting, performance calibration, and talent development
      • Lead the key interface to our site People Managers on all tools available that will assist individual and team performance improvement at all levels.
      • Provide counsel and mentorship to Leadership on all people management and development issues within this part of our workforceEmployee / Labor Relations:
        • Establish and maintain effective "win - win" working relationships with (and between) managers, supervisors, and employees
        • Build and maintain relations with employees at the manufacturing site, to promote and foster an environment of open communication and transparent, candid feedback.
        • Conduct investigations, provide coaching, and document findings, when required. Compliance:
          • Supporting a holistic safety focus by driving people related safety goals and business initiatives
          • Ensure all EEO compliance and Affirmative Action programs/plans are being implemented successfully Requirements:
            • A Bachelor's (BA or BS) in Human Resource Management or related field (e.g., Business, Organizational Communication, Industrial Psychology) is required.
            • 3+years of experience in a professional level Human Resources role.
            • Manufacturing Plant, Distribution Center, Sales, or Direct Sales Distribution (DSD) environment is preferred.
            • Knowledge of Federal and State employment laws, Investigation Skills, HR technical knowledge in EEO, AA, FMLA, ADA, unemployment, and worker's compensation
            • Willing and able to work under pressure to meet tight deadlines with minimal supervision.
            • Must be willing and able to travel up to 10% based on the needs of the team and the business.Preferred Experience:
              • HR change management experience - implementation of a change management project within a non-corporate setting (i.e., Such as implementing the new service or benefit concept to employees).
              • Experience in labor-management relations, workplace investigations, and managing mediation, arbitration, and/or grievance processes.
              • Human Resource experience should include familiarity with and experience in recruitment, labor relations, and continuous employee engagement and communications. You will have demonstrable knowledge of applicable HR laws and applications, employee relations/coaching and performance management experience.
              • Be proficient in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ook, and Access) and an HRIS system (such as PeopleSoft or SAP)
